"Adolf and his Crazy Gang And Other Topical Cartoons. A Collection of 50 Inspirations by Butterworth. Reproduced from the Daily Dispatch".
Printed circa 1942. In cartoon style illustrated softback covers. Book has some smudging and transferance on covers, due to war time printing. Spine has damage, but holding. Some watermarks / foxing. Otherwise in a good condition.

George Butterworth (1905-88) was a cartoonist and sports reporter for the British publication 'Daily Dispatch'. He subsequently appeared on Hitler's "death list" (according to Wikipedia)!
